public class SessionObservableFilterObservableFilterImpl extends java.lang.Object implements SessionObservableFilter, java.io.Serializable
| コンストラクタと説明 |
|---|
SessionObservableFilterObservableFilterImpl(Filter filter) |
| 修飾子とタイプ | メソッドと説明 |
|---|---|
SessionObservableFilter |
add(LogicalOperator operator,
SessionObservableFilter filter)
条件を追加する。
|
boolean |
equals(java.lang.Object value) |
Filter |
getFilter(Session session)
Observableとsessionを評価してfilterを取得する
|
boolean |
getResult(Observable observable,
Session session)
Sessionの内容を元にobservableの評価を行う
|
int |
hashCode() |
java.lang.String |
toString() |
public SessionObservableFilterObservableFilterImpl(Filter filter)
public boolean getResult(Observable observable, Session session) throws FatalException
SessionObservableFiltergetResult インタフェース内 SessionObservableFilterFatalExceptionpublic SessionObservableFilter add(LogicalOperator operator, SessionObservableFilter filter)
SessionObservableFilteradd インタフェース内 SessionObservableFilteroperator - 接続論理演算子filter - 追加条件を表すフィルタpublic Filter getFilter(Session session) throws FatalException
SessionObservableFiltergetFilter インタフェース内 SessionObservableFilterFatalExceptionpublic java.lang.String toString()
toString クラス内 java.lang.Objectpublic int hashCode()
hashCode クラス内 java.lang.Objectpublic boolean equals(java.lang.Object value)
equals クラス内 java.lang.Object